Transaction 78d85187981594a033f72bc237f8c0278248038da70bff678501169b0591f937
1 Input
1 Output
-
78d85187981594a033f72bc237f8c0278248038da70bff678501169b0591f937:0
- value
- 186077
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1ce3b605a5118a7a631ee44468afceaf778fb15
- address
- bc1qc88rkcz62yv20f33aezydzhuatmh37c4ak3stg